Output 26afc88406ffd771762c61b761db84a6013c4a1e21f98fadf58558c26b296417:3
- value
- 42279
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bd67d303e6be8788dabf2299f5982645a732625
- address
- bc1q80t86vp7d0583rdt7g5e7kvzv3d8xf39904cca
- transaction
- 26afc88406ffd771762c61b761db84a6013c4a1e21f98fadf58558c26b296417
- confirmations
- 49737
- spent
- true